Is HUGO BOSS made in China?

German fashion house Hugo Boss is currently testing out the production of men’s suits in China, its boss Bruno Sälzer told Thursday’s edition of German business daily Handelsblatt. The company already manufactures T-shirts in China and is having some suits made there now to test the quality of production, Sälzer said.

Are HUGO BOSS suits made in Turkey?

Izmir, Turkey is home to HUGO BOSS’s largest production location. On an area of around 65,000 m2, suits, jackets, shirts and coats are produced, and almost 4,000 workers are employed in Izmir.

Where do they make the Hugo Boss suits?

All suits are made in Germany at the HUGO BOSS headquarters in Metzingen, where ultramodern tailoring methods combine with exquisite craftsmanship in the unique BOSS art of tailoring. BOSS Made to Measure stands for sartorial perfection, with every element individually defined.

Which is the largest segment of Hugo Boss sales?

In 2009, BOSS Hugo Boss was by far the largest segment, consisting of 68% of all sales. The remainder of sales were made up by BOSS Orange at 17%, BOSS Selection at 3%, BOSS Green at 3% and HUGO at 9%.

When did Hugo Boss first start selling sunglasses?

In 1984, the first Boss branded fragrance appeared. This helped the company gain the required growth for listing on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ange the following year. The brand began sponsorship of golf with Bernhard Langer in 1986 and tennis with the Davis Cup in 1987. In 1989, Boss launched its first licensed sunglasses.

When did Hugo Boss change to Hugo Boss?

In 1967, Hugo Boss’s nephews, Uve and Jochen, took over the management of the company and began to transform it into what it is today. They changed their marketing strategy and company name into Boss. Between 1960 and 1970, Boss products became synonymous with men’s luxury accessories and costumes. In 1970, the brand became exclusively male.

When did Hugo Boss start making SS uniforms?

Wikimedia Commons SS uniforms produced by Hugo Boss. In 1931, two years before the Nazi Party took control of the German government, Hugo Boss started his fashion label in Metzingen, Germany. Even before then, Boss had numbered among Germany’s Nazi collaborators, producing early Nazi uniforms in a factory he’d bought in 1924.

How old was Hugo Boss when he started his business?

Boss started his eponymous label at the age of 33 in the Swabian town of Metzingen, Germany in 1931, prior to the Nazi party’s rise as the governing body of the country.

Where does the undercollar on Boss suits come from?

Crafted from Irish linen and cashmere, the undercollar is stitched by hand to ensure an impeccable shape, while jacket, sleeve and waistband linings are as personal as the main fabric of the suit, each chosen to perfectly complement the rest of the look. BOSS Made to Measure accessories are handmade in Italy to the highest standards.
